How Apple’s Vertical Integration Changes Laptop Procurement Strategy for SMBs
A deep-dive SMB procurement guide to Apple pricing, RAM economics, lock-in, and what to negotiate on fleet buys.
How Apple’s Vertical Integration Changes Laptop Procurement Strategy for SMBs
Apple’s laptop strategy is not just a product strategy; it is a procurement strategy. When a vendor controls the chip design, operating system, industrial design, memory architecture, retail pricing, and software ecosystem, it changes how buyers should evaluate total cost, negotiate contracts, and plan fleet refreshes. For SMBs, this matters because the usual rules of laptop purchasing—compare CPUs, add RAM later, ask for a bigger discount—do not always work the same way in an Apple ecosystem. In a market shaped by memory price volatility and faster product cycles, Apple’s vertical integration can create both leverage and lock-in at the same time.
The practical implication is simple: procurement teams need to think beyond sticker price. Apple can absorb some upstream cost pressure, such as rising RAM costs, because it has tighter control over component selection and platform design than most PC vendors. That can produce lower list prices for certain configurations over time, as seen in the broad movement from premium “base” pricing toward more aggressive mainstream pricing on MacBook Air configurations. But the same control can also make upgrades expensive at purchase time and difficult or impossible after the fact, which changes bargaining power, lifecycle planning, and fleet standardization. 1) What Apple Vertical Integration Actually Means for SMB Procurement
Apple controls more of the stack than most laptop vendors
Vertical integration in Apple’s case means the company owns more layers of the computing stack than the average OEM. Apple designs its own silicon, controls the operating system, tightly specifies memory and storage options, and integrates hardware and software features around a single platform architecture. That reduces dependency on outside suppliers and lets Apple optimize performance-per-watt, battery life, and chassis design in ways that are hard for competitors to match quickly. For procurement teams, this means Apple’s pricing is not simply a reflection of commodity component costs; it is a reflection of platform economics.
This is where SMB buyers often misread the market. A Windows laptop quote may look cheaper on paper because it uses modular parts, wider vendor competition, and more configurable BOM options. But that apparent flexibility can come with hidden costs in imaging, support variability, driver issues, and inconsistent battery performance. Why this changes bargaining power
Traditional procurement assumes you can push suppliers on component upgrades, alternative chassis, and competitive bid pressure. Apple’s model narrows that room to negotiate at the hardware level because the company offers fewer bespoke configurations, fewer reseller pathways, and more standardized product tiers. That can reduce line-item flexibility, but it can also simplify buying decisions and make fleet planning more predictable. If you are negotiating a fleet refresh, the conversation shifts from “Can we customize every device?” to “Which Apple configurations minimize lifecycle cost for this role?”
This is a major difference for SMBs with limited IT staff. Instead of spending cycles on hardware variance, you can spend them on rollout readiness, policy enforcement, and lifecycle control. Why Apple’s ecosystem feels “opinionated” in procurement terms
Apple’s platform is opinionated because it makes certain decisions for the buyer. Memory is usually unified and fixed at purchase. Storage is also fixed. Accessories, device management, and compatibility patterns are shaped around Apple’s preferred workflow. For some teams, that is frustrating; for others, it eliminates decision fatigue and reduces support variance. Procurement teams should interpret this not as a lack of choice, but as a tradeoff: fewer knobs to turn, but usually higher consistency and lower operational entropy.

2) Price Drops, RAM Economics, and Why the Math Keeps Changing
The MacBook Air example shows how pricing power can shift
The most useful procurement lesson from recent Mac pricing is that Apple’s standard business configurations have become substantially more affordable over time. One widely discussed example is the 13-inch MacBook Air with 16GB RAM and 512GB storage, which moved from a much higher price point to a more accessible mainstream level after Apple shifted to its own silicon. That matters because SMB buyers often use the MacBook Air as their volume workhorse: sales teams, managers, operations staff, and general knowledge workers. When that base configuration drops meaningfully, the unit economics of fleet refresh improve immediately.
For a company refreshing 20 laptops per year, even a few hundred dollars per device is material. Over a 3-year refresh horizon, the savings can free budget for better MDM, extended warranty coverage, or more capable devices for power users. This is one reason procurement teams should not evaluate Apple solely on premium pricing history. In markets where the baseline is changing, today’s “expensive” vendor may be tomorrow’s cost-efficient standard. RAM cost absorption is a strategic advantage, not a pricing accident
RAM economics are central to understanding Apple’s current advantage. Global memory demand has been distorted by AI infrastructure growth, and that pressure tends to affect vendors that rely on commoditized third-party memory supply more acutely. Apple’s silicon architecture and procurement scale let it absorb or smooth some of that pressure better than many PC competitors. When other vendors are exposed to memory price spikes, they often pass those increases through in configuration pricing, which can punish buyers who need 16GB or 32GB standardization.
Apple’s ability to “absorb” memory cost does not mean memory is free; it means Apple can rebalance margin, platform pricing, and product mix more flexibly. For SMB buyers, the lesson is to watch configuration deltas carefully. If the RAM bump from base to recommended spec is large, that is often where vendor margin is hidden. If you need consistency across the fleet, ask whether the upgrade is truly priced at cost or if the vendor is monetizing the buyer’s fear of obsolescence. Why list price is only one part of the economic story
Procurement teams should separate acquisition cost from operating cost. A MacBook with a lower failure rate, longer battery life, and fewer support tickets may outperform a cheaper Windows notebook in total cost of ownership even if the upfront price is higher. Conversely, a company that needs niche Windows-only software, heavy local admin privileges, or specialized drivers may find that the premium is not justified. There is no universal winner; there is only a better fit for a given workload.
That is why fleet refresh decisions should be tied to role-based profiles rather than generic budget caps. A customer success rep, a finance analyst, and a software engineer do not have the same requirements, so they should not get the same device by default. Apple’s pricing strategy works best when the buyer uses it to simplify roles into standardized tiers, then reserves premium devices only where they deliver measurable output. 3) Vendor Lock-In: The Hidden Cost and the Hidden Benefit
Lock-in starts with software, but procurement feels it in support and switching costs
Vendor lock-in is often framed as a software problem, but procurement teams feel it through total switching friction. With Apple, device lifecycle policies, app distribution, security controls, and identity integration all become more powerful when you commit deeper to the platform. That can be a benefit if your company wants fewer endpoints to manage and cleaner user experience. It can become a cost if your team later wants to switch to another platform and discovers that workflows, training, and management tools are too tightly coupled to Apple.
That is why SMBs should think of lock-in as a spectrum rather than a binary. Some lock-in is beneficial because it reduces operational drift and simplifies support. Too much lock-in raises your dependence on one vendor’s roadmap, pricing cadence, and product segmentation. If you want to keep optionality open, you should negotiate around services, enrollment flexibility, and exit planning—not just hardware price. Why Apple lock-in is often more tolerable for SMBs than for large enterprises
Large enterprises may have many legacy systems, region-specific compliance rules, and deeply customized software environments, which makes platform lock-in more painful. SMBs, by contrast, often have smaller IT stacks and can standardize faster. That means the cost of choosing Apple can be lower if the business is willing to adopt a cleaner software stack and a modern device management approach. In this scenario, vendor lock-in is not necessarily a trap; it can be a deliberate simplification strategy.
However, SMBs can still overcommit if they buy the wrong device mix or fail to negotiate enough flexibility. For example, if you purchase a large share of fixed-memory notebooks for users whose needs may grow, you can create an expensive replacement cycle. Likewise, if your business needs Windows for one critical application but buys Macs everywhere else, you may end up maintaining a complicated split environment with two support models. The best buyers treat lock-in as a managed risk, not a philosophical debate.
When lock-in becomes an asset
Lock-in can be valuable when it creates predictability. If your company wants employees to travel with a single battery profile, unified update process, and fewer accessories, Apple’s ecosystem provides that predictability better than many alternatives. If your team uses cloud-first tools and remote management, the consistency can reduce onboarding time and IT overhead. This is one reason Apple can feel especially attractive to companies optimizing for “move fast, support less.”
Still, buyers should preserve leverage wherever possible. That means avoiding deeply proprietary accessory dependencies, keeping data in portable formats, and choosing identity and MDM tools that do not hard-code a single vendor as the only acceptable endpoint. 4) What SMBs Should Negotiate For When Buying Apple Devices
Negotiate the configuration, not just the sticker price
The most common procurement mistake is asking for a discount without specifying the business outcome. With Apple, buyers should negotiate around configurations that match workload tiers. If 16GB RAM is the practical minimum for your knowledge workers, then negotiate around that standard and document why it is non-negotiable. If 512GB storage is required for offline media, secure file caching, or local datasets, make that part of the procurement request.
In practice, this improves your bargaining position because it frames the purchase as workload-aligned standardization rather than upselling. Resellers and account reps are more likely to offer concessions on bundles, accessories, service terms, or financing than on raw device configuration. Ask for pricing on volume, not on isolated units, and compare the quote against your projected refresh cadence. Ask for MDM and deployment support up front
For SMBs, MDM prioritization should be part of the buying conversation, not an afterthought. The best procurement deals are not just about devices; they include Apple Business Manager enrollment, automated device assignment, policy templates, and support for your chosen MDM platform. If the seller can help with zero-touch deployment, that can cut implementation time and reduce human error. The value of this support is especially high if your team is scaling remote work or replacing a mixed fleet.
Too many businesses focus on procurement savings and then lose those savings in IT labor. If your deployment team has to manually enroll every laptop, configure every security setting, and patch every app by hand, the labor cost can erase device discounts. That is why buyers should request explicit onboarding support and documentation. Negotiate service, warranty, and replacement terms
With Apple, the after-sale terms can matter as much as the hardware. Buyers should ask about accidental damage coverage, extended warranty options, swap turnaround times, and whether advance replacement is available for critical users. If a laptop failure stops revenue-generating work, a slightly better service contract may be more valuable than a small unit discount. This is especially true for teams with distributed staff or travel-heavy roles.
Also ask how replacements are handled during the warranty period and whether the vendor can preserve inventory consistency across refresh batches. One hidden risk in fleet refresh is that you buy mixed revisions with different ports, display characteristics, or battery behavior over time. Consistency is part of value. 5) Fleet Refresh Strategy: How to Time Replacement Cycles Around Apple Economics
Standardize by role and refresh by performance threshold
Apple’s vertical integration makes it easier to standardize by role because performance tends to remain strong across the lineup for longer than many buyers expect. That means some SMBs can extend refresh cycles beyond the traditional 3-year window, especially for general office work, sales, and light creative workloads. But the right cycle depends on battery health, app requirements, storage headroom, and whether your software stack has grown heavier. A laptop is “good enough” only until it starts creating friction for the user or the support team.
The best refresh strategy is threshold-based, not calendar-based. Define replacement triggers such as battery degradation, inability to support the latest OS version, or repeated storage pressure. Then pair those triggers with role-based assignment rules. In this sense, Apple’s platform helps procurement become more like capacity management than guesswork. Use Apple’s pricing stability to smooth capital planning
One advantage of Apple’s more predictable product ladder is that it helps finance and procurement align on future spend. If the most common business configuration becomes cheaper and stays relatively stable, you can forecast refresh costs with less uncertainty. That is valuable for SMBs that need to keep payroll, software subscriptions, and device replacement all under control at once. Predictable laptop economics are not exciting, but they make cash planning easier.
Still, a lower list price can also tempt businesses to buy too little device for the workload. Apple’s pricing may encourage standardization, but you should not mistake “affordable” for “adequate.” If an employee’s job truly needs more memory or a higher-tier chip, buy that configuration once instead of replacing underpowered devices later. Short-term savings often become long-term churn, and churn is expensive. When to choose MacBook Air vs MacBook Pro in procurement terms
For many SMBs, the MacBook Air is the volume winner because it delivers enough performance for a broad range of office tasks at a more attractive price. The MacBook Pro becomes the rational choice when workloads genuinely require sustained performance, higher memory ceilings, better thermals, or more advanced GPU usage. That includes some developer, design, analytics, and content creation roles. Buying the Pro for everyone is wasteful; buying the Air for everyone can be equally wasteful if the team hits performance limits.
Procurement should map device tiers to work output, not to job titles alone. A title can conceal real requirements, so ask what applications the user runs, how often they multitask, and whether they rely on external monitors or local storage. The right fleet is usually mixed, but intentionally mixed. 6) Comparison Table: Apple vs Typical Windows Procurement Economics
| Procurement Factor | Apple Vertical Integration | Typical Windows OEM Model | SMB Procurement Implication |
|---|---|---|---|
| Upfront pricing | Often higher at the low end, but better value in mainstream configs over time | Can look cheaper initially, especially in base models | Compare total cost, not just entry price |
| RAM upgrade economics | Memory is usually fixed at purchase, making the upgrade decision front-loaded | More configuration options, but upgrade pricing can vary widely | Buy enough memory on day one if the role requires it |
| Deployment consistency | High consistency across hardware and OS stack | More variability across OEMs, chipsets, and drivers | Apple can reduce support overhead in standard fleets |
| Vendor leverage | Less room to negotiate deep hardware customization | More room to shop among vendors and channels | Negotiate services, terms, and lifecycle support |
| Lock-in risk | Higher ecosystem dependence, but often with better workflow coherence | Lower ecosystem lock-in, but more support fragmentation | Preserve data portability and exit options |
| Refresh planning | More predictable platform roadmap and pricing bands | Broader variation in feature changes and pricing | Use role-based refresh intervals and thresholds |
7) Procurement Checklist: What to Ask Before You Sign
Questions about configuration and workload fit
Before issuing a purchase order, procurement should ask: Which teams really need this device? What are the heaviest applications they run? How much memory and storage are required today, and what will be needed 18 months from now? These questions sound basic, but they are the difference between a strategic purchase and an expensive assumption. If you do not define workload fit, you will likely overbuy in some places and underbuy in others.
It also helps to build a simple approval matrix. For example, office staff may get a standard configuration, analysts a higher-memory tier, and creative or technical staff a Pro model. That makes exceptions defensible and prevents ad hoc upgrades from slipping into the budget. Questions about support, security, and manageability
Ask whether the devices will be enrolled in Apple Business Manager, how they will be assigned to MDM, and who owns the policy templates. Confirm whether the seller supports supervised deployment, automated app installation, and OS update controls. If your organization needs compliance documentation, ask for warranty records, serial tracking, and repair escalation procedures. These operational details often determine whether the devices will be easy to manage or merely easy to buy.
This is also where security and identity decisions matter. A laptop fleet should support fast sign-in, secure authentication, and compliant device posture without burdening users. In many companies, that means MDM is not an optional administrative tool; it is the control plane that makes the fleet usable. Questions about lifecycle and exit options
Ask how long the device class is expected to receive OS support, whether the seller offers buyback or trade-in programs, and what happens if your business needs to switch platforms later. Also request clarity on repair logistics, turnaround times, and any region-specific service restrictions. These questions help you estimate the true economic life of the asset, not just its invoice life. That is especially important for SMBs that need predictable depreciation and replacement plans.
Finally, avoid treating resale value as a bonus. It is part of the economic calculation. Apple devices often retain value better than many alternatives, which can reduce the net cost of ownership. But that only matters if you preserve the devices, maintain them properly, and refresh them on a rational schedule instead of running them into obsolescence.
8) Real-World SMB Scenarios: Where Apple’s Strategy Helps and Hurts
Scenario 1: A 25-person professional services firm
A consulting or agency business often values portability, battery life, and fast onboarding more than hardware tinkering. In this setting, Apple’s vertical integration can reduce support load and make hybrid work simpler. The firm can standardize on a few configurations, keep the image light, and use MDM to enforce basic controls. If the business runs mostly SaaS and browser-based workflows, Mac can be a strong fit.
The procurement win here is not just lower support cost; it is lower complexity. If staff travel frequently, predictable battery performance and consistent accessories matter. A small team does not have the luxury of a sprawling endpoint support organization, so reducing device variance is often worth more than squeezing another 5% off the invoice. Scenario 2: A retail operator with tight margins
A retail business may care more about device durability, POS compatibility, and support availability than about premium industrial design. Apple can still work well here, but only if the software stack is compatible and the devices are used in clearly defined roles. If the business needs ruggedized or highly modular hardware, another platform may be better. Procurement should not force an Apple standard into environments that need different hardware economics.
For retail and operations leaders, the key question is whether the Apple premium is offset by lower friction in scheduling, communication, and management. If yes, the spend may be justified; if not, the business may need a more commodity-oriented purchasing model. Scenario 3: A fast-growing tech startup
Startups often benefit from Apple because the combination of developer-friendly hardware, strong battery life, and lower support burden makes scaling easier. But startups also risk overcommitting if they assume every employee should get a top-tier configuration. The right approach is to buy in layers: standard devices for most staff, premium configs only for specialized roles, and a clear MDM policy from day one. That minimizes waste and keeps future growth manageable.
If your company is aggressively scaling, standardization can be more valuable than marginal customization. The ideal procurement posture is to preserve flexibility while locking in the controls that matter most. That may include a preferred reseller relationship, a predictable refresh schedule, and pre-approved upgrade tiers. The goal is to turn hardware buying from a reactive expense into a managed operating system for the business.
9) Negotiation Tips That Actually Improve Outcomes
Use volume, timing, and standardization as leverage
Even when a vendor has strong pricing power, SMBs can create leverage by consolidating demand and timing purchases carefully. A 20-unit refresh is more attractive than four separate 5-unit purchases. End-of-quarter or end-of-cycle buying may also yield better terms, especially if the buyer can accept one standard configuration. The cleaner the order, the easier it is for a reseller to justify concessions.
Buyers should also be explicit about what they can trade. If price cannot move much, ask for free accessory bundles, a longer warranty, onboarding support, or swap stock commitments. These extras can deliver more value than a small discount. Treat the negotiation like a package, not a unit price contest. Negotiate around fleet standards, not individual exceptions
One of the best ways to reduce total cost is to create a standard device policy and negotiate around it. The more exceptions you allow, the more support complexity you create. If your procurement team can say, “These are our standard roles and these are the only acceptable configurations,” vendors are more likely to respond with structured offers. That structure improves comparability and helps finance approve the spend faster.
This also helps with replacement planning. If all devices in a role share the same baseline, you can replace them in batches, simplify spares inventory, and reduce training time. Standardization gives your company operational leverage, and operational leverage is often more valuable than a one-time discount.
Negotiate for future-proofing, not just current specs
Because Apple’s RAM and storage are fixed at purchase, the buyer should negotiate with a future horizon in mind. If a 16GB configuration is enough today but likely to feel tight in two years, ask whether a higher tier is more economical than replacing the device early. This is where procurement strategy meets lifecycle management. A slightly higher configuration can be the cheaper choice if it extends useful life by a full refresh cycle.
That is especially important in a market shaped by memory price swings and broader component inflation. The safest buying move is often to lock in the configuration that minimizes future risk, not the one that looks lowest on the page.

FAQ
Is Apple always more expensive for SMB fleet purchasing?
No. Apple can have a higher entry price on some models, but that does not automatically mean a higher total cost. If the devices reduce help desk work, last longer on battery, retain resale value, and simplify deployment, they may be cheaper over the lifecycle. The key is to compare total cost of ownership, not just invoice price.
Should SMBs buy more RAM than they need because Apple memory is fixed?
Usually yes, if the device will be used for several years and the workload is stable. Because memory is generally not user-upgradable on modern Apple laptops, the purchase decision is front-loaded. If a role is likely to grow in complexity, it is often cheaper to spec up at purchase than to replace the device early.
What should we negotiate if Apple won’t discount hardware much?
Focus on warranty terms, replacement speed, onboarding help, accessory bundles, and MDM/deployment support. You can also negotiate on volume commitments and standardized configurations. Many SMBs get more value from support and lifecycle concessions than from a small sticker discount.
Does Apple vertical integration increase vendor lock-in risk?
Yes, but the risk is manageable. Apple’s integrated stack can increase ecosystem dependence, especially around device management and app workflows. However, if you keep data portable, use flexible identity tools, and avoid proprietary business processes, you can reduce lock-in while still benefiting from Apple’s consistency.
When is a MacBook Pro a better procurement choice than a MacBook Air?
Choose the Pro when the workload needs sustained performance, heavier multitasking, higher memory ceilings, or better thermal headroom. That typically applies to developers, creative professionals, and some analytics roles. For general office work and lighter SaaS-based workflows, the Air is often the better value.
How should MDM influence our Apple purchasing decision?
MDM should be part of the buying decision, not an afterthought. If your chosen MDM supports Apple well, deployment and policy enforcement become much easier. If it does not, the savings from cheaper hardware can disappear into manual setup labor and security gaps.
